  • Download MALWAREBYTES (Make sure you click 'DOWNLOAD LATEST VERSION')
    http://www.filehippo.com/download_ma..._anti_malware/
    Open malwarebytes and goto UPDATE and click 'check for updates'. After its updated goto SCANNER and click PERFORM FULL SCAN then click SCAN
    Remove everything thats found (needs to be ticked)
    Post the COMPLETE log here AFTER youve deleted everything it finds


    reboot

    Download HIJACK THIS (Make sure you click 'DOWNLOAD THIS VERSION')
    http://www.filehippo.com/download_hijackthis/2894/
    Click MAIN MENU then DO A SYSTEM SCAN AND SAVE A LOGFILE(Takes seconds) then post the log so we can see whats running
    (do NOT do anything else with Hijack but scan and post the FULL log)

    Might not be able to download them if the virus is blocking or redirecting HTTP traffic. Best bet is to download them on another machine, put them onto a memory stick and then run them up on the infected machine in safe mode.

    You may need to rename the executable files too as some malware stops well known files from running (e.g. mbam.exe).

    You could download the rkill.exe program to run in Safe Mode first, it stops a lot of known problem services.
